Runbook: restoring customer accounts affected by the Tellwright query planner regression. The bad plan caused login lookups to time out, locking some accounts automatically. For each ticket, verify identity per standard policy, then run the unlock script from the support bastion. The script will prompt once for the recovery passphrase, which appears below.

vault phrase of bagaf-kajeg = jorath-feniel-briir-siliel-ralix

Account Recovery — Pagewright Static Builds

If a customer loses access to their Pagewright dashboard, incremental rebuilds of their static site will continue from the last known-good deploy, so no content is lost during recovery. Confirm the customer's last rebuild timestamp in the Orlin console, then initiate the recovery flow from the admin panel. Do not trigger a full rebuild until access is restored. Unlocking the recovery flow requires the passphrase below.

recovery phrase for yadup-taguf: wenael-quenox-kelix

TURN-208: Gatevale turnstile counters at the Merrow Field pilot double-count when a rotation reverses mid-cycle. Attendance totals drift roughly 2% high per event. The debounce window fix is implemented, reviewed by Ilsa, and soak-tested across two simulated match days without drift. Ready for your cut; the candidate build is identified below.

trace token, tagag-tafog: htk6_5ed18c

**Ticket #4471: StaleSweep bot deleting plugin demo branches**

Hey plugin authors — our branch cleanup bot, StaleSweep, has been a bit overeager and pruned some `demo/*` branches on the Hollowfort plugin registry that were quiet but still referenced in docs. We've paused the bot and are restoring from mirror. If your demo branch vanished, reply here. The build token of the misbehaving bot release is below.

session token of kageg-tahop = htk14_af3c1ccccb7dcf

# Break-Glass: Catalog Cache Invalidation

Scope: the Pinrow product catalog at Veldstone Retail. If stale prices persist after a purge and the Hollowmere invalidation queue is wedged, use break-glass to flush the edge tier directly. Contractors: get verbal sign-off from the catalog lead first. Steps: open the Hollowmere admin shell, select emergency-flush, confirm the tenant, and run it once — repeated flushes thrash the origin. Access is logged and expires after 20 minutes. Unseal the admin shell with the passphrase below.

recovery phrase for kahop-tajog: istix-casvan